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blue Dolphin | plicate door snail |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Mollusca (Mollusks)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Gastropoda (Gastropoda) |
| Order |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) | Stylommatophora (Stylommatophora) |
| Family | Delphinidae (Oceanic Dolphins) | Clausiliidae |
| Genus | Stenella | Macrogastra |
| Species | Stenella coeruleoalba | Macrogastra plicatula |
Evolutionary Relationship
Blue Dolphin and plicate door snail share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
